17. Plaque
painted with the
lyrics and score
of Topeing Jack
or Jack Thou’rt
a Toper by Henry
Purcell for the
play Bonduca.
Probably Bristol,
c.1750. Tin-glazed
earthenware,
height 33
cm. (Private
collection; exh.
Bristol Museum
and Art Gallery).

18. Plate
decorated on the
border in bianco
sopra bianco and
inscribed ‘RICHD
WOOD / Port
Isaac / 1764’.
Bristol, probably
Redcliffe Back
factory, 1764.
Tin-glazed
earthenware,
diameter 34 cm.
(Bristol Museum
and Art Gallery).

19. Desk set
inscribed ‘RC
1685’ on sander
and bowl. Perhaps
Brislington,
1685. Tin-glazed
earthenware,
16.8 by 10.8 cm.
(Bristol Museum
and Art Gallery).
